because unlike say in some desert or taiga region, you cannot have 100s of such convoys on the move all over the country from the point of view of running cost, wear and tear etc. so they would be based at some mil cantonments here and there and move out only when our threat perception is high...returning back when all clear is sounded. each couple of missile TELAR unit would need other vehicles for C3I, physical security, earth moving eqpt to repair damaged launch sites or unblock roads, tankers for fuel, food trucks, medical trucks, mobile weapons test lab, radiation monitors...it has to be equipped to function totally autonomous without expecting any help from civil admin or other mil units for upto 2 weeks.
these bases would be easy to locate using satellite imagery and humint reports. so one fine day a surprise pre-emptive strike could wipe out all these limited number of places in theory or atleast take out a good part. this would immediately open the gate to surrender negotiations given our degraded retaliatory posture...the enemy daring us to strike back with 10 stones when he has 100.

Further, the unique trajectory of Shourya means its immune to BMD. Most BMDs rely on reducing the 'closing speed' of the two projectiles by lobbing up the interceptor, and then bringing it down in a parabolic trajectory, with a velocity thats in the same direction as the target. This reduces the relative velocity of the target and the interceptor considerably and allows a HTK or a directional warhead. The unique trajectory of Shourya means that BMD wont work against it, and a different, (currently non existent) solution will be needed to intercept it.

Ravi, This is what I think Arihants are, all IMHO: The Arihant is a BAe Hawk for the nuclear navy (Pilatus PC-7 role to be played by the Nerpa) - viz stepping stones to greater capability. They will validate technologies, designs, procedures, doctrines, and demonstrate operational capability via deterrence and denial patrols. Assuming the Arihants do prove to be viable in service then by 2030 or so we will see two offshoots in full bloom; one a full fledged SLBM carrier with ICBM range and the other a smaller conventionally armed SSN.
The small size is not motivated by doctrine as far as I can tell but by fiscal pragmatism. i.e. The small size and small numbers built will minimize costs of a capability development program that will not offer any tangible operational benefits in the near term. The Arihant as it stands (even with 1500km reach) is too much for Pakistan and too little for China.
Another thing I would like to mention is that it is a very bad idea to mix SSBN and SSN roles. If you send an Arihant to the Bohai just to sink the Varyag, the PRC will freak out assuming you want to nuke Shanghai. You know how the military mind works - capability, not intentions. To reinforce deterrence you will have to make a clear cut and well published distinction between your conventional and MAD assets to minimize misunderstanding. An Arihant SSBN/SSN hybrid you envisage blurs that distinction and reduces stability.
regarding SSBN security: I am not confident that we are technologically at a level where we can ensure boomer security purely through stealth. We might need an combined arms efforts ala the soviet bastion concept.
I am also unconvinced that there is a straight correlation between size and stealth of submarines for a given technological level. viz, within reason sheer size will not hugely impact your passive acoustic signature. But size will dramatically impact your carry, endurance and persistence - vital parameters for a deterrence patrol. I am positing that for a real SSBN the trade off of unit cost vs fleet cost, stealth vs endurance will be in favor of a larger boat.

The Army has so far placed orders for three regiments of the supersonic cruise missile and with today's test firing, two of them have been inducted operationally.
The Defence Ministry has also given a go ahead to the Army to induct a third regiment for being deployed in Arunachal Pradesh along the China border.
One regiment of the 290-km range BrahMos consists around 65 missiles, five mobile autonomous launchers on Tatra vehicles and two mobile command posts, among other equipment.
